Craven County Schools is proud to celebrate eight outstanding students who have been selected to participate in the North Carolina Governor’s School, the oldest statewide summer residential program for gifted and talented high school students in the nation.

The North Carolina Governor’s School is a four-week program designed for some of the state’s most gifted and talented rising high school students. The program integrates academic disciplines, the arts, and unique courses across two campuses, giving students the opportunity to explore cutting-edge ideas and concepts in academics and the arts.

Governor’s School emphasizes collaboration across disciplines and encourages students to engage deeply with the latest ideas in their selected area of study. Students are chosen through a competitive selection process after being nominated by their public school unit or non-public school. The program is administered by the State Board of Education and the North Carolina Department of Public Instruction through the Office of Advanced Learning and Gifted Education.
